Sundaram Home expands in MP

Sundaram Home Finance is strengthening its footprint beyond South India with a focused push into Tier 2 and 3 towns, announcing the expansion of its operations in Madhya Pradesh (MP).

The company has inaugurated two new branches this week in Pithampur and Ratlam in MP, bringing its total branch count in the state to five. The move aligns with the company’s strategy to grow its presence in select high-potential markets outside its traditional stronghold in the South.

With this latest expansion, Sundaram Home Finance is aiming for disbursements of ₹300 crore in Madhya Pradesh during the current financial year. The new branches will add to the existing network in the state, which includes two branches in Indore.

“This expansion in Madhya Pradesh is in line with our stated intent of identifying select growth opportunities in Tier 2 and 3 towns outside South India and building a stronger base in states where we are already present,” said D. Lakshminarayanan, Managing Director of Sundaram Home Finance.

He added that MP is an important market for us outside South India. Rapid industrial growth is leading to increased affordability among the customers in the state. Over the last 12 months, we have seen a strong demand for home finance in larger towns like Indore and Bhopal in the mid-segment, with a typical ticket size of around ₹40 lakhs. We expect the demand for residential properties to take off in smaller towns such as Pithampur and Ratlam and are confident of leveraging the increasing growth opportunities in the state,” he said.

The company had crossed a significant milestone last year, with disbursements outside South India surpassing ₹1,000 crore.

The expansion in Madhya Pradesh marks a continuation of this momentum as Sundaram Home aims to diversify its geographic presence and tap into the rising demand in underpenetrated regions.
